The utility model discloses an anal decompression device, which comprises a decompression tube body, one end of the decompression tube body is connected with a foreign matter bag, and a balloon assembly is sheathed on the outer wall of the other end of the decompression tube body; The inside of the decompression tube body is provided with pipe fittings, and the outside of the decompression pipe body is provided with a drug delivery device and a flushing device. The drug delivery device communicates with the flushing device, a sampling port is opened on the wall of the decompression tube body, and a sampling port blocking member is provided on the sampling port. Open the plugging part of the sampling port to directly sample the sample in the decompression tube body; squeeze the medicine into the patient's body by squeezing the medicine storage bag to complete the administration; when flushing the inside of the decompression tube, squeeze the water storage bag , the water body flows into the inside of the decompression pipe body through the pipe fittings to complete flushing.

直肠手术术后会吻合肠管,吻合口存在漏粪水的风险。目前,通过在直肠内放置一个减压管,使得粪水和气体能够排出来,从而降低直肠内的压力,进而降低吻合口漏粪水的风险。但是,公知的肛门减压管无法实现对减压管管道内部的冲洗以及通过减压管为患者给药,也不能实现对减压管管道内样本的取样化验。After rectal surgery, the intestinal tube will be anastomosed, and there is a risk of fecal water leakage at the anastomotic port. At present, by placing a decompression tube in the rectum, the fecal water and gas can be discharged, thereby reducing the pressure in the rectum, thereby reducing the risk of fecal water leakage from the anastomosis. However, the known anal decompression tube cannot flush the inside of the decompression tube and administer medicine to the patient through the decompression tube, nor can it realize the sampling and testing of the samples in the decompression tube.
综上,目前亟需一种能实现对减压管内部管道冲洗,能直接通过减压管管道对患者给药和冲洗以及可以对通过减压管管道对样本取样的装置。To sum up, there is an urgent need for a device that can flush the internal pipeline of the decompression tube, can directly administer medicine and flush the patient through the decompression tube, and can sample the sample through the decompression tube.
